vedel

Dutch

Alternative forms

Etymology

From Middle Dutch vēdele. Cognate to English fiddle.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ˈveː.dəl/
  • Hyphenation: ve‧del
  • Rhymes: -eːdəl

Noun

vedel f (plural vedels or vedelen, diminutive vedeltje n)

  1. A vielle, a precursor to the violin.
  2. (dated, dialectal) A violin.
